Episode description

We explore the quantitative, scientific, and data-driven new frontier of coaching. 

  • Major League baseball is undergoing a coaching revolution from old-school to new tech. We talk to players whose careers were turned around not by a charismatic coach, but by data, and the techies who coach them.
  • We see how data coaching is creeping into the workspace with a computerized conversation coach that has pinned the successful sales pitch down to a science.

A while back in two thousand and three, I published a book called Moneyball. It's about how the Oakland A's baseball team had used data analysis to get an edge on everyone else. They were a

poorly funded team in a small market. They had no money to spend on players, but their new and better statistics enable them to value baseball players more accurately, so they could sell the players that were overvalued and trade for the ones that were undervalued. I remember at the time being shocked at the notion that baseball players could be misvalued. I mean, baseball players have been doing the same job for a century, out in the open, in

front of millions of people. But suddenly, all over a thing that had been done a certain way forever was now being done a totally different way. Everyone in baseball started using data and getting all sorts of insights from it, and the insights led not just to better valuations of baseball players, it eventually led to a new kind of coaching. In the past, it used to be that many coaching positions were almost a sine cure. That's Ben Lindberg, co

author of a book called The MVP Machine. It's about a revolution in how the world's best baseball players get coached. It was the coaches who were the manager's palace, his drinking buddies would become the coaches, and there wasn't that much coaching going on at the major league level. It was sort of reinforcing lessons that had already been taught and keeping guys in line, but there wasn't that much expectation that coaches would improve players once they got to

that level. But that was about to change big time. Ben was part of a huge and growing crowd of data geeks outside of baseball who spent lots and lots of time analyzing players and building models to try to

predict their performance. As sophisticated as the statistical projection models are, they'll only really look at the player's past performance and his age and maybe some comparable players from the past, and they'll spit out a projection that say, well, he was this good in the past few years, and we'll adjust for the ballpark, and here's how old he is, and so here's our median projection for him, and so all of a sudden, there players who are just busting

out of those projections exactly, And a projection system would never forecast that. It might say that someone's going to get a bit better, a bit worse, but typically it won't say that someone is going to do something that's completely out of line with their past performance. In other words, teams had gotten really good, or at least a lot better at evaluating the potential of all their players, but the players were still playing better than expected, so much

better that the analysts were a bit suspicious. But the last time you saw this was with the steroids era, that all of a sudden, people players were performing in ways that the projection models would never have guessed. And you're so you're kind of seeing it, but without an explanation as obvious as steroids exactly. Yeah, then started looking into what these players were doing. The ones who were dramatically exceeding the analysts expectations, the overperformers, all had something

in common. Coaches who use new technology. One of the really big innovations has been the high speed camera. So a company called Edgrotronic, which developed these cameras for scientific purposes, has found that much of its business has come from baseball teams because baseball teams have found that if you train these high speed cameras on players, you can perceive things about players movement that they didn't know about themselves. He doubled down on his approach, and he wound up building what amounted to a baseball bionic manfactory drive line Baseball, he called it. So describe to me this laboratory you build. In its current incarnation, it's about fifteen high speed motion tracking cameras. There's force plates in there to measure ground

reaction forces. Attracts every movement two hundred forty times per second, and it's submillimeter accurate, so every movement can be tracked down to at least one millimeter of accuracy, and usually much better. Let's go one hundred point four ninety three point seven the high speed cameras allow Kyle to measure the speed of a pitcher's arm, among other things, the faster a pitcher's arm, the faster the ball comes out

of it in theory one hundred three point zero. In practice, not all pictures are able to translate their arm speed into ball speed. Two guys with the exact same arm speeds might throw very different fastballs. If someone's arm speed is extremely high and the ball comes out at like a lower predictive velocity based on like a regression algorithm, that we know that there's some inefficiencies there that we

should be able to easily clean up. That is, you could identify people with the god given talent to throw a baseball because you had new insight into where that talent came from. About five years ago, I was CEO and at a software company and we're growing pretty quickly. This

is a meet bendoff. Five years ago, he was just another Silicon Valley entrepreneur trying to get his product out the door by using salespeople. But I was puzzled why some of our people were more successful than others. And every time we wanted to understand why, we had to go and interview people and see what they think. And he didn't want just a collection of stories. He wanted data. Why did some sales pitches work while others didn't? Think

about like football right or baseball right? If the coach never sees the game and the only thing is to understand how to get better is by interviewing some of the players what they think has happened. So I wanted to have like something like a game tape and game stats for sales and AI to understand what really separates the top performers from everybody else. You know that message that you get on customer service calls, This call may

be recorded for quality assurance. We appreciate your patience. Calls for quality. Companies were recording their sales calls, but no one was really listening to them. A met wanted to listen to all the game tape and analyze it. And I then started asking a bunch of other people, you know, if we build a system kind of shine a light on conversation and give you insights from that. Would you buy how much you're willing to pay a meat? Created

a new company he called it Gong. He went to people and said, hand me all the recordings of all your sales calls, plus a list of your salespeople in order of how good they are. We'll analyze it. And so if you'd gone to just one of those top sales people and ask what you're doing, it works. No, no, absolutely not, because they don't know. People think it's an art, right. It's like they're not aware that's something that they're doing because they don't know what the other people are doing,

so they don't know what the differences are. The Gong artificial intelligence, had no theory about what worked and what didn't in sales. It just had millions of sales pitches. It searched for patterns in both the calls they got results and the calls that didn't. The Gong actually learns like it looks at the salespeople and says, like, which one is closing more deals, and then it starts to analyze the difference. So the software learns automatically. You just

connect to the calls. If there was an art to any of this, it was in the questions that Gong asked if the phone call data. I mean, the very simple one is like percent of talk time? Right, You and I are talking right now, and by the end of the call, Gong say, well, a meat was talking fifty six percent of the time. It turns out there's lots of things that separated great sales pitch from a bad one. The simple virtues. They're sort of obvious, but

they could now be quantified. On average, forty six percent talk time is ideal. Thirteen questions is optimal? Right? Not less? No more so, this alone is food for thought that there's a maximum amount of time to be talking. I mean there's like, uh, this is not some kind of magic, it's just like facts. But there's something else that happens with data. In the right analysis of it, it causes all kinds of folk beliefs

to just disappear. Let me give you an anecdote. So, a lot of the managers and the coaches are often obsessed with the filler words. When we introduce the product, Oh, can you track like fuller words, you know, like oombs and arms and like and so and like. It drives them nuts. But you know what, we ran the research and turns out there's zero correlation between like usage of filler words and success. Huh, So, so that parameter doesn't really matter. The managers were thinking that the more filler

words the worse. Yes, right, it is annoying to hear them when you listen to recording and there's and people say like a hundred times it drives you nuts, right right. The fact is it doesn't matter. The fact is you never know any of this without all these facts. Gong is screwing up everybody's assumptions. Like the recent one was using swear words on calls, does it help, does it get in a way or does it even matter? And what's the answer. Um, So it depends what the correlation,

what the research shows. I said, it depends on what you're selling, Like if you're selling bibles, it probably doesn't help. Yeah, yeah, we didn't have any Bible sellers over there in the stats. But it's run over like, you know, fifty thousand people, so it's it's a very large number. But the corollary is that it depends who starts first. If the buyer starts with curse words and you match that that that's actually works better. But if you start it it doesn't help.

You might fucking believe that, or you might fucking not. The point is that it doesn't matter what you believe. The data generates the knowledge, and the knowledge allows you to coach people how to do better at the most basic human activity talking. Allison wood Brooks is an associate professor at the Harvard Business School. Like, we're on a date, do you want to go out with me again? We're on a sales call? Did it convert to a sale?

All kinds of things that you can connect the content of the conversation with things that really matter, with outcomes that really matter. Professor Brooks takes all these conversations and analyzes them. She's using the same new machine learning that Gong uses, but she's looking for different things. Give me an example, one example of something that you can you learn from this technology, Like something someone says that leads the other person to want to go on a date.

Let's give you that exact example. We have a data set of people doing speed dating. Each person went on like twenty dates, okay, quick four to five minute speed dates in round robin fashion. At the end of each date, you say are you willing to go out with that person again? And they record and transcribe all the interactions. So now we see exactly what people are saying on their dates, and we can measure what are the things that people are doing and saying that make them more

likely to be more datable in the future. And one thing that really matters is question asking. So asking more questions for both men and women on these heterosexual dates leads to better dating outcomes. Really, especially follow up questions. How do you know that the people who are asking the questions aren't just naturally more attracted to the people who they're asking the questions of. Because so two things. One we can control for other aspects of attractiveness observational

data too. We then come back to Harvard and run experiments where we tell people ask a lot of questions in one condition or another condition where we say we don't tell them anything. In the condition where they're asking a lot of questions, they also are more attractive and likable. Do you sense that the challenge with men is different from the challenge with women. We do have

a good amount of research on gender in conversation. For example, we know Matthias Melt the University of Arizona has this great paper showing that men and women are equally talkative and even though women have the stereo type of being chattier, what he finds is that men and women both speak about sixteen thousand words per day, so that's about similar. But what we do know from other researches that men and women speak at different times, especially in the workplace.
